Irving,
Have you prioritised an English dictionary?
In case you haven't...... type "Merriam" in Library. Right click on the dictionary, chose prioritise and place it high on prioritise list.
Now the dictionary will appear in the Right Click / Look Up section.
Also, if its the top of the list, left click on an English word in a resource will open the dictionary.
